Your first tai chi class at Elements of Change

Nervous about walking into a tai chi class for the first time? Almost everyone is, and good instructors expect beginners to come through the door. Here's what to know. What to expect: a typical first class is a gentle warm-up, then learning a few slow movements of the form, step by step — no pressure to get it perfect, and you can rest or sit whenever you need to. What to wear: loose, comfortable clothing you can move in, and flat, flexible shoes (some studios practice in socks or bare feet). What to bring: water, and that's about it — there's no equipment to buy. Arrive a few minutes early to say hello to the instructor and mention it's your first class. It comes together faster than you'd think — most people feel far more at ease by their second or third visit.

Tai chi is gentle and low-impact, but it's still exercise, and the health notes here are general information, not medical advice. If you have any injuries or health concerns, mention them to the instructor before class, and check with your doctor before starting a new exercise program.
